Marsella has a stock in Lazio, in Rome in particular, but also in Roccasecca, Pico, Villa Santa Lucia, Cassino, Aquino and Casalvieri in the frusinate, and in Fondi in the Latin, one in Naples, Rocca d'Evandro in the Caserta area and Vallo della Lucania in Salerno, and one in Salento, in Maglie Calimera, Scorrano and Martano in Lecce, Maruggio, Taranto and Crispiano in the Taranto area and Oria and Brindisi in Brindisi, could derive from an Italianization of the name of the French city of Marseille (Marseille ), or even from a Frenchised matronymic form of the name Marcella.
